Duties include but are not limited to:

  • Structuring, reviewing, drafting, negotiating, and enforcing with Project Commercial team of design agreements, client agreements, subcontract agreements, partner agreements, purchase orders, NDAs, Notice of Change and others.
  • Draft/support negotiations and administration of Project specific standard forms (Subcontract, Material Contract, PSA, Purchase Agreement, and Trucking Agreement), including the protocols necessary to review with Project Senior Management, Project Procurement & Commercial Teams and if necessary, to consortium team members, and where required, provide advisement to Project members overall.
  • Provide training on contracts, standard form agreements for Project Procurement, Senior Management, Commercial and Change Management.
  • Assist with the review of contract documents, identify, and analyze legal risks and report on legal risk in order to mitigate risks.
  • Point reference to Project Team for all matters concerning Prime Contract with Client.
  • Work with Project Team members to identify significant cost, schedule, contractual issues and advise on drafting appropriate notice and correspondence.
  • Review and advise on matters related to utility and right-of-way agreements, property owner disputes, etc. This would include advisement to Project Management, Third Parties and other Stakeholder groups.
  • Support Project Team members in tracking, advancing and responding to matters related to contract change events. Including risk management related to insurance related property damage and third party related utility damage claims.
  • Provide support on legal elements of issues or crisis management, e.g. employment disputes, contract disputes, and provide input on the decision whether to send matters to outside counsel and assist in the oversight of outside counsel as necessary.
  • Advise and support Project Senior Management on matters related to serious project safety incidents from the legal perspective, responding to third party complaints, lawsuits or other significant community issues on the Project.
  • Clear written communication and effective interaction with a variety of operational roles will be critical, as will the ability to establish rapport and credibility with stakeholders across the project team.
  • Other duties as required.

The successful candidate will have the following:

  • A current license to practice law in Ontario and member in good standing with the Law Society of Ontario.
  • 8+ years of post-call experience at a well-respected law firm or in-house construction legal department.
  • Superior written and oral communication and interpersonal skills in complex and at times adversarial situations, with the ability to communicate effectively at all levels of the organization as well as the ability to establish rapport and credibility with stakeholders across the project team.
  • Sound judgement and legal reasoning, excellent analytical skills, and creativity in solving problems.
  • Demonstrated ability to develop strategies to succeed, present a clear plan to the client, and communicate instructions rigorously and precisely.
